The snazzy little HDR-TG7 from Sony has certainly got a distinctive look. The new camcorder, which adopts a vertical form factor, films in 1080i and is aimed at travellers who are looking for a lightweight, discreet video camera.The main difference with its predecssor, the HDR-TG3 is the inclusion of 16 GB of flash memory allowing you to film for nearly two hours. The TG7 also comes with a handful of other features, including GPS-based geotagging and face recognition.
